“"The general rule is that constitutional provisions and amendments thereto must be harmonized where practical. If there is to some extent an inconsistency or repugnancy between a provision of the Constitution and an amendment thereto so that one or the other must yield, the amendment, being the last expression of the sovereign will of the people, will prevail as an implied repeal to the extent of the conflict. The same rule of construction would apply in the construction of amendments. The latter amendment would govern to the extent that it was repugnant to, or in conflict with, the provisions of the former one. [Citing cases]. The principle of constitutional construction above laid down has been uniformly adhered to and applied according to the varying facts of the different cases."”
